About the Forum
The Forum for Catholic Discipleship Lectures promotes the holistic formation of adult Catholics through encounters with truth, beauty, and goodness, while being accompanied in spiritual friendship the entire way.
About Our Presenter 
Bryan Mercier is an on-fire Catholic speaker, author, and apologist. For more than two decades, Bryan has given life-changing youth retreats, keynote talks, Parish Missions, apologetics seminars, leadership training, and more. He spoken on TV and radio shows around the country including Sirius XM Satellite Radio, Ave Maria Radio, Relevant Radio, and EWTN. Bryan is the founder and president of Catholic Truth, an organization that reaches millions of people across the globe. Catholic Truth teaches and builds up the Church using effective apologetics and evangelization, faith formation, and more than 10 social media platforms. Catholic Truth currently has close to 100,000 subscribers on YouTube and almost 1,000 videos online. Bryan has written two books and is working on five more.

OCIA: Open Office Hours
OCIA Open Office Hours is an optional monthly gathering for Pastors and OCIA coordinators. This is an opportunity to discuss questions about any part of the OCIA process, including, but not limited to, canonical questions, pastoral planning, how to develop a curriculum, how to form and prepare unformed teenagers and children for the reception of the sacraments, mystagogy, and other topics related to OCIA ministry.
The purpose of these sessions is to support those serving in OCIA ministry by providing practical guidance, concrete resources, and actionable steps to strengthen and enrich their parish's OCIA process.
